Aurora Energy Research Limited is seeking a Financial Planning & Analysis Manager based in Oxford. The successful candidate will oversee the FP&A function, responsible for performance reporting, budgeting, and forecasting.
Applicants should have qualifications as an accountant and experience in finance leadership roles.
The position offers private medical and dental insurance, a salary-exchange pension, and other benefits, with a commitment to hybrid working arrangements.

How to prepare for a job interview at Aurora Energy Research Limited
✨Know Your Numbers
As an FP&A Manager, you'll be expected to have a solid grasp of financial metrics. Brush up on key performance indicators relevant to budgeting and forecasting. Be ready to discuss how you've used data-driven insights in your previous roles to influence decision-making.
✨Showcase Leadership Experience
This role requires finance leadership skills, so prepare examples that highlight your experience in leading teams or projects. Think about times when you’ve successfully guided your team through challenges or implemented new processes that improved efficiency.
✨Understand the Company’s Vision
Research Aurora Energy Research Limited thoroughly. Understand their business model, recent developments, and how they position themselves in the market. This knowledge will help you tailor your responses and demonstrate your genuine interest in contributing to their goals.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Practice articulating your thought process when faced with financial challenges, such as budget cuts or unexpected variances.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ers effectively.
